How much do distribution managers make?
How much does a Distribution Manager make? The average distribution manager salary is $84,711 per year, or $40.73 per hour, in the United States. People on the lower end of that spectrum, the bottom 10% to be exact, make roughly $58,000 a year, while the top 10% makes $122,000.
What degree do you need to be a distribution manager?
A distribution manager has to have a high school diploma as a minimum. However, more and more commonly, a business or management bachelor’s degree is also required. Most have significant experience in warehouse management, and have an understanding of current shipping technology.
What does a distribution manager do?
Distribution managers determine when product is distributed, where it is sent and what volume is to be distributed. This role is a key player in the logistics and supply chain management realm, and leverages information systems and software to enable strong forecasting and effective program implementation.

What makes a great distribution manager?
Managing a warehouse requires people skills, namely the ability to lead and motivate employees. A great warehouse manager leads by example, including treating coworkers with respect, welcoming and listening to the ideas of others, remaining fair at all times and empathizing with subordinates.
What does a distribution assistant do?
Distribution assistants can work in the building, food, shipping/receiving, and general service industries. They may be in charge of preparing items for distribution or shipment. They may verify incoming shipments or verify distribution is accurately scheduled.
What is the difference between distribution and logistics?
A key difference between logistics and distribution is that logistics relates to the overall planning and organisation around the movement, storage and inventory control of goods, whereas distribution is more related to the actual physical placement of the goods.
What is a distribution clerk?
Distribution clerks monitor shipments and process orders in warehouses. This includes tasks such as checking orders for damages, fulfilling shipment orders, and communicating with vendors for prices and order queried.
